One of our clients. a water treatment company in the Southeast. was generating around 80 leads per month from a mix of Google Ads and organic traffic. They were closing about 12 of them. That's a 15% close rate.

After the audit, we discovered the real number: they were only ever reaching about 45 of those 80 leads. The other 35 were slipping through before anyone called them back. Fixing that alone was worth $180,000 in additional annual revenue.

The Problem: A Spreadsheet That Couldn't Keep Up

Their “CRM” was a Google Sheet. Someone checked it once in the morning and once in the afternoon. Leads that came in on Friday afternoon didn't get called until Monday. Leads that called during a job. when the owner was busy. never got called back at all.

This isn't negligence. It's what happens when a small business grows faster than its systems. The solution isn't more discipline. it's better infrastructure.

The System We Built

We implemented Go High Level as the central CRM and built the following automation sequence:

  • Instant multi-channel response: Within 60 seconds of a new lead, the system sends an SMS (“Hi, this is [Company]. We received your request and will call you in the next 2 minutes.”), an email with the free water test offer, and triggers an outbound call attempt.
  • AI voice agent first touch: If the owner is busy, the AI agent makes the first call, qualifies the lead, and attempts to book a free water test appointment.
  • 14-day follow-up sequence: Leads that don't book immediately enter a 14-day sequence of alternating calls, texts, and emails. Frequency starts high (3 touches in day 1) and tapers to 1 per week through day 14.
  • Dead lead re-engagement: Leads that go 30 days without converting are moved to a separate “re-engagement” sequence that runs a softer, lower-frequency follow-up for another 60 days.

The Results

Within 30 days of the system going live, contact rate went from 56% to 89%. Monthly booked appointments increased from 12 to 31. Revenue grew from approximately $48,000/month to $124,000/month. on the same ad spend.

The leads didn't get better. The system around them got better.

The Setup Cost and Time

Building this system typically takes 2 to 3 weeks. CRM configuration, pipeline setup, automation sequences, AI agent training, and integration testing. After that, it runs with minimal maintenance and no manual lead management required.
